Output 05008ec00afc73b82174d591ac52c483b294c1c4ce9e4ea31a5cc2e1925c7b80:1

value
11422697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 026777264d1d6395ed989ed2bc1a38a7c4338e5e OP_EQUAL
address
31ujDqB4iUEV2xfkduEvobMdp1TPyisVcC
transaction
05008ec00afc73b82174d591ac52c483b294c1c4ce9e4ea31a5cc2e1925c7b80
confirmations
398481
spent
true